Public Affairs and Economic Development has two separate but complimentary functions.
The Public Affairs responsibilities include shaping campus posture in the public sector and facilitating the campus community's interaction with our community. The University Missouri mission statement and the UM-St. Louis Master Plan charged the campus with support for economic development in our region.
